Tesla's November Market Surge: A Sign of Things to Come or Just Holiday Hype?
Tesla’s market cap exploded in November, outpacing other giants. Is this surge sustainable or a temporary bubble fueled by speculation around a Trump-era deregulation of self-driving cars? While the potential easing of regulations could be a game-changer, is it enough to justify such a dramatic increase? What other factors might be contributing to this growth?
Consider this: Walmart, JPMorgan Chase, Amazon, and Visa also saw significant gains, largely attributed to positive holiday shopping trends. Does this suggest a broader market upswing, with Tesla simply riding the wave? Or is there something unique about Tesla's position, making it particularly susceptible to these regulatory whispers?
The article also highlights the impact of geopolitical tensions on tech companies like Taiwan Semiconductor Manufacturing Company and Nvidia. How might these global dynamics further influence Tesla's trajectory, considering its international presence and reliance on supply chains?
